A Review of MOSC and Dvorak

The final performance of the Midland-Odessa Symphony Chorale's season was the short but stirring Mass in D by Dvorak. The audience was sparse and appeared to consist mainly of family members of those singing.

In The Limelight

In The Limelight will provide a forum for discussion of the local performing arts scene. The moderator, Graham, will provide reviews of local events such as plays, concerts, lectures etc. Occasional pieces will also appear on 'dramas' of a wider kind, particularly of a criminal nature. Graham Dixon was born and raised in England, but has spent much of his adult life in America. He came to the US as a Fulbright Scholar, was meant to stay a year but ended up never leaving. He has a B.A. in History/Geography from Exeter University, an M.A. in Speech (and tailgating) from LSU, and a Ph.D. in Dramatic Art from UC Berkeley. He has acted and directed professionally and wrote drama reviews for "The Daily Californian" at Berkeley. A former Professor and Dean, he now dedicates his time to photography and writing.
